Despite completing a massive $3 billion share repurchase initiative, UBS shares are facing significant downward pressure as investors focus on a looming regulatory confrontation with Swiss authorities. The completion of the capital return program, which would typically boost shareholder value, is being entirely overshadowed by concerns that the bank could be forced to hold billions in additional capital.

The primary driver behind the negative sentiment stems from Bern, where discussions are intensifying around substantially stricter capital requirements for systemically important banks. Market participants are growing increasingly anxious over analyses suggesting the Swiss government could mandate UBS to maintain up to $24 billion in extra core capital.
